Transaction 52fdbdfb75451354b792dc2eceff803a1a016df3824eea74231ebc7c230ef93a

43 Input
2 Outputs
  • 52fdbdfb75451354b792dc2eceff803a1a016df3824eea74231ebc7c230ef93a:0
  • value  82700000
    address  3H1WYNfziioaQB6PrB78cZK1xsTkhW4Dow
  • 52fdbdfb75451354b792dc2eceff803a1a016df3824eea74231ebc7c230ef93a:1
  • value  747470
    address  3NGX7d8H4A4h1q58ge3X19HCeAKR5o8Hxo